ABOUT US
At the Department of Community Services (DCS), we are a large and diverse department providing a broad portfolio of programs and services including Child and Family Well-being (CFW), Employment Support (ESS), Income Assistance (IA), Homelessness and Supportive Housing, and Disability Support (DSP).
Through our services, we advocate and help vulnerable Nova Scotians be independent, self-reliant, and secure. We work collaboratively across the province with a strong dedicated network of supports and staff, to achieve desired and shared outcomes for all.
PRIMARY ACCOUNTABILITIES
You will provide support to the Regional Service Delivery Manager, employees, and visitors. Your primary responsibilities include:
- Efficiently coordinating electronic calendars, arranging and organizing meetings, including handling travel accommodations
- Preparing agendas and capturing accurate minutes/notes during meetings, along with the preparation of various confidential correspondence spanning our various programs.
- Reviewing, sorting, and distributing incoming mail promptly
- Responding to inquiries from the public, and agencies while ensuring a positive and informative experience.
- Assisting in organizing various aspects of the hiring processes, coordinating staff training and other staff engagement activities.
- Ordering and tracking purchases and inventory, reconciling monthly credit card statements, and overseeing petty cash.
QUALIFICATIONS AND EXPERIENCE
You will have a one (1) year business administration course plus a minimum of three (3) years of administrative support experience, or an equivalent combination of training and experience.
You thrive in a team-oriented environment, readily stepping in to support colleagues and displaying a proactive approach. You are proficient in Microsoft programs such as Word, PowerPoint, Outlook, Excel, or equivalent office software. You’re comfortable working autonomously in a fast-paced, challenging work environment and managing tasks effectively. Demonstrating a high degree of tact and diplomacy is second nature to you, especially when dealing with sensitive issues. Meticulous organization is your forte and your keen eye for detail ensures nothing slips through the cracks. You demonstrate an ability to build and maintain positive working relationships and collaborate effectively.
We will assess the above qualifications and competencies using one or more of the following tools: written examination, standardized tests, oral presentations, interview(s), and reference checks.
